Ezzard Charles 193 lbs beat Paul Andrews 189 lbs by SD in round 10 of 10

"Ezzard Charles moved a little further on the comeback trail toward another heavyweight title chance Thursday night, but handlers of Paul Andrews charged that the win resulted only from a low blow and faulty scoring by a fight judge. Charles won a split decision over Andrews in the Chicago Stadium televised fight. But Andrews scored the only knockdown of the fight, putting Charles on the canvas for the compulsory eight-count in the 2nd round. Andrews had Charles in trouble in the first three rounds and Charles got the victory only because he fought out of a crouch thereafter, working inside on the body expertly and kept Andrews confused with his attack, shifting occasionally to the head. Then in the 10th round Charles landed a punch to Andrews' stomach which sent him doubled up against the ropes. Even though Charles won, the victory wasn't impressive." -United Press

  • Unofficial Salina, Kansas-Journal scorecard - 97-94 Andrews
  • The winner of this bout was to meet Tommy 'Hurricane' Jackson next. And Charles met him on August 3rd.
